Lorene Frances Baker 1933–2008 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 14 MAR 1933

Birth Location: Bloomington, IL, USA

Death Date: 9 OCT 2008

Death Location: Midland Co., TX, USA

Father: Floyd Baker

Mother: Dorothy Paterson

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

Lorene Frances Baker was born in 1933 in Bloomington, IL, USA, the child of Floyd Elmer Baker And Dorothy E Paterson. Lorene Frances Baker married Howard Wallace Scott. Lorene Frances Baker passed away in 2008 in Midland Co., TX, USA.
